Cullumber Manufacturing Inc. shipped finished goods inventory with a total cost of $56,500 to FFA Retailing Ltd. on May 1. The agreement between the two companies was that FFA was to sell the product on consignment for Cullumber Manufacturing. Cullumber incurred $4,900 in shipping costs in order to ship the merchandise. FFA paid a local newspaper $3,200 for advertising costs (which Cullumber promised to reimburse). At September 30, the end of the accounting year for both companies, FFA had sold 75% of the merchandise for total sales of $60,200. FFA notified Cullumber of the sales, retained a 20% commission, and remitted the cash due to Cullumber.

Problem a) Prepare the journal entries required by the above transactions on the books of Cullumber Manufacturing.

Problem b) Prepare the journal entries required by the above transactions on the books of FFA Retailing.
